你查询的IP:[59.191.118.26]  地理位置:中国–广东

最新查询120.80.135.143 221.198.183.164 58.66.85.26 221.8.50.210 120.52.21.93 221.42.5.41 119.28.95.108 210.22.16.142 116.66.71.237 59.191.118.26 116.216.114.22 119.59.128.149 203.223.106.41 58.66.151.36 123.232.160.33 122.152.192.109 202.170.128.106 119.108.48.6 119.32.31.43 202.38.136.53 203.134.240.56 121.58.242.14 124.172.101.37 203.171.224.250 58.14.60.36 58.66.211.73 124.14.116.107 218.96.225.41 119.248.49.90 120.137.120.121 124.192.21.175